Doha Insurance cancels plans to establish new property company

Doha – Mubasher: Doha Insurance Company cancelled its plans to establish a new real estate company, as its board dismissed the development of a land plot in Lusail city.

Earlier in December 2015, the Qatar-listed company signed a contract to sell a land plot at Marina, Lusail, for QAR 145.293 billion, resulting in a net profit of QAR 78.4 billion.

The company said on Monday that land sale proceeds will be used in pumping additional liquidity which helps in boosting the financial position of the company.

The company’s share declined 4.76% to QAR 20 in today’s mid-trading.
